Port Glasgow station makes ticket purchasing convenient with its ticket office, which operates extensive hours from 06:15 to midnight on weekdays, and a ticket machine for quick access. If you've purchased your tickets online, collection is a breeze using the accessible ticket machines provided at the station. You can also find smartcard validators, perfect for tapping through gates with minimum hassle, although smartcards aren't issued directly at this station.
For travelers requiring accessibility, Port Glasgow station caters well with step-free access throughout the entire facility. There is also help available from station staff and accessible platforms that ensure a comfortable journey for all. An induction loop system is in place, enhancing the experience for hearing aid users. For those traveling with bicycles, there are stands capable of storing ten bikes, albeit without CCTV coverage for security monitoring.
Port Glasgow station's connectivity doesn't end at the terminals. The bustling locale offers convenient connections to bus and taxi services, making onward travel straightforward. Rail replacement buses and local public buses drop off and pick up readily available on Princes Street, ensuring your journey continues seamlessly. For those traveling from Ulverston, the station has you covered with a ticket office open on Monday from 06:00 to 19:30 and on Sunday from 08:00 to 18:15. If you prefer using machines, ticket machines are available round-the-clock for buying tickets or collecting tickets purchased online. The station is thoughtfully equipped with accessible ticket machines and an induction loop to assist hearing-impaired passengers. Despite the absence of an accessible toilet or waiting room, the station ensures accessibility with step-free access available in parts of the station. If you have mobility challenges, friendly staff are on hand to assist through the 'barrow crossing' outside staffed hours by dialing 0800 138 5560 for additional help.
Arriving at Ulverston and wondering about the next leg of your journey? The station offers a variety of transport links that can smoothly connect you to your next destination. Whether you need to board a rail replacement service or hail a taxi, options are readily available at the front of the station. For seamless onward travel planning, check out the bus schedules for local services, or hire a bicycle from nearby Gill Cycles. Need a more personal ride? Visit Cab4You for taxi services.
